CIBELAE (Corporación Iberoamericana de Loterías y Apuestas de Estado) is an international non-governmental, non-profit organisation founded in October 1988. It serves as the official regional branch of the World Lottery Association for Ibero-America, uniting state-owned lottery and betting organisations from Latin America, Spain, and Portugal. The association acts as the political, advisory, and training body for its members, fostering collaboration, innovation, and responsible management in the state gaming sector. Membership includes government-backed lotteries, regulatory bodies, and private-sector technology suppliers and operators as associate members. CIBELAE provides a platform for knowledge exchange, capacity building, and advocacy on regulation, security, and player protection. Key activities include an annual congress, thematic seminars, online training via the Campus CIBELAE e-learning platform, and working groups on security, innovation, anti-fraud, and responsible gaming. The organisation is led by a President and an Executive Director, with governance from a Board of member representatives. History & Founding
CIBELAE was created in October 1988 as the Iberoamerican Corporation of Lotteries and Bets of State. It was established by state lottery organisations from Ibero-American countries with the aim of promoting cooperation, information exchange, and the modernisation of the lottery sector across the region. While the specific founding members are not publicly listed, the organisation has grown to encompass members from more than 20 countries, including both state operators and private-sector associate members. It is recognised as an Associated Member of the World Lottery Association, giving it a formal role within the global lottery community.
Structure & Governance
CIBELAE operates as a non-profit civil association with unlimited duration. Its highest authority is the General Assembly of member organisations, which elects a Board of Directors. The Board appoints a President and an Executive Director to oversee day-to-day operations and strategic implementation. The President is typically a senior figure from a member lottery, while the Executive Director manages the secretariat and programme execution. The current President is Javier Milián, who also serves as President of the National Lottery of El Salvador (LNB). The Executive Director is Rodrigo Cigliutti.
Membership
Full membership is open to state lottery and gaming organisations from Ibero-American countries (Latin America, Spain, Portugal). Associate membership is available for private-sector companies – such as technology providers, gaming operators, and consultants – that wish to engage with the state lottery ecosystem. Notable recent associate members include EveryMatrix and Altenar, announced in 2025/2026. Membership provides access to events, working groups, research, and advocacy efforts.
Activities & Services
CIBELAE’s work is centred on six core objectives: promoting research and studies for modernisation; encouraging integration among member lotteries; facilitating cooperation agreements; advising on homogeneous legislative policies; organising courses, seminars, congresses, and conferences; and promoting international agreements to combat illegal gambling. These are delivered through an annual congress (e.g., the XIX Congress in Asunción, Paraguay, November 2025), thematic seminars (such as the 2026 Costa Rica seminar on illegal gambling and security), the Campus CIBELAE e-learning platform, working groups on security, responsible gaming, anti-money laundering, and digital transformation, and publications and research.
Impact & Reach
CIBELAE is the primary voice for state lotteries in the Spanish- and Portuguese-speaking world. Its network includes organisations from over 20 countries across Latin America, as well as Spain and Portugal. The organisation has reported record activity years, with multiple in-person seminars and webinars attracting hundreds of attendees. It collaborates closely with the WLA and other international bodies to set standards for security, integrity, and responsible gaming.
